阿里OceanBase之OMS迁移工具部署
omsconfig.yaml
# OMS 元数据库信息
oms_cm_meta_host: 192.168.1.110
oms_cm_meta_port: 3306
oms_cm_meta_user: root
oms_cm_meta_password: 11111111!
oms_rm_meta_host: 192.168.1.110
oms_rm_meta_port: 3306
oms_rm_meta_user: root
oms_rm_meta_password: 11111111!
# 用户可以自定义以下三个数据库的名称,OMS 部署时会在元信息库中创建出这三个数据库
drc_rm_db: oms_rm
drc_cm_db: oms_cm
drc_cm_heartbeat_db: oms_cm_heartbeat
# OMS 集群配置
# 单节点部署时,通常配置为当前 OMS 机器 IP(建议使用内网 IP)
cm_url: 192.168.1.111:8088
cm_location: 80
# 单节点部署时,无需设置 cm_region
# cm_region: ${cm_region}
# 单节点部署时,无需设置 cm_region_cn
# cm_region_cn: ${cm_region_cn}
cm_is_default: true
cm_nodes:
- 192.168.1.111
# 时序数据库配置
# 默认值为 false。如果您需要开启指标汇报功能,请设置为 true
# tsdb_enabled: false
# 当 tsdb_enabled 为 true 时,请取消下述参数的注释并根据实际情况填写
# tsdb_service: 'INFLUXDB'
# tsdb_url: '${tsdb_url}'
# tsdb_username: ${tsdb_user}
# tsdb_password: ${tsdb_password}开始安装部署
拉取对应镜像后
sudo docker run --name oms-config-tool harbor.oceanbase-dev.com/obartifact-temporary/amd64/oms/5202507291827/oms:4.3.0_bp2_x86_all_in_one bash && sudo docker cp oms-config-tool:/root/docker_remote_deploy.sh . && sudo docker rm -f oms-config-tool
sh docker_remote_deploy.sh -o /data/oms/ -c /data/config.yaml -i 192.168.1.109 -d harbor.oceanbase-dev.com/obartifact-temporary/amd64/oms/5202507291827/oms:4.3.0_bp2_x86_all_in_one
进入web控制台进行相应的数据迁移操作!
评论区